什么是云服务器云主机的工作原理
-
云服务器(Cloud Server)或云主机(Cloud Hosting)是基于云计算技术的一种虚拟化技术,可以提供灵活、可扩展和高可用的计算资源。它的工作原理主要包括:虚拟化、资源池化、自动化和负载均衡。
首先,云服务器通过虚拟化技术将物理服务器划分为多个独立的虚拟服务器(虚拟机),每个虚拟机具有独立的操作系统、应用程序和配置。这样,每个用户都可以在云服务器上部署自己的应用,并独享一定的计算资源。
其次,云服务器采用资源池化的方式管理计算资源。资源池化将所有物理服务器的计算资源(包括CPU、内存、存储等)集中管理,形成一个统一的资源池。当用户需要增加或减少计算资源时,系统可以根据需求动态地分配或回收资源,使资源得到最优的利用。
自动化是云服务器的另一个重要特点。云服务器平台提供了一套自动化的管理和控制系统,可以自动完成虚拟机的创建、部署、管理和监控等工作。用户只需要通过简单的界面或API命令就可以完成这些操作,大大减少了人工干预,提高了运维效率。
最后,云服务器通过负载均衡技术来实现高可用性和可扩展性。负载均衡将用户的请求均匀地分配给多个物理服务器上的虚拟机,实现了资源的平衡和利用率的最大化。当某个物理服务器故障或超载时,负载均衡系统会自动将请求转发到其他正常的服务器上,保证用户的应用不受影响。
综上所述,云服务器或云主机通过虚拟化、资源池化、自动化和负载均衡等技术实现了灵活、可扩展和高可用的计算资源,并提供了简便的管理和控制方式,大大提高了计算资源的利用效率和应用的可靠性。
1年前 -
云服务器(Cloud Server)或云主机(Cloud host)是一种基于云计算技术的虚拟服务器,它提供了灵活的计算资源和存储空间,并且可以根据需要进行动态扩展。以下是云服务器或云主机的工作原理的五个主要点:
-
虚拟化技术:云服务器使用虚拟化技术将物理服务器划分为多个虚拟实例。每个虚拟实例都有自己的操作系统和应用程序,独立运行。这种虚拟化技术使得多个用户可以共享同一物理服务器,同时保持彼此之间的隔离性和安全性。
-
弹性扩展:云服务器可以根据用户的需求进行动态扩展。当用户需要更多的计算资源时,可以通过增加虚拟实例的数量或增加每个实例的计算能力来满足需求。同样,当需求减少时,可以减少虚拟实例的数量或降低每个实例的计算能力,以避免资源浪费。
-
负载均衡:云服务器可以使用负载均衡技术来平衡用户请求的分布。通过将用户请求发送到多个虚拟实例上,负载均衡器可以确保每个实例的负载相对均衡,从而提高整体性能和可靠性。当某个虚拟实例负载过高时,负载均衡器可以将请求转发到其他空闲实例上。
-
高可用性:云服务器通常提供高可用性的架构。通过在多个地理位置部署虚拟实例,云服务器可以保证即使一台物理服务器发生故障,用户的应用程序仍然可用。当一台物理服务器出现问题时,云服务器可以自动将虚拟实例迁移到其他可用的物理服务器上,从而实现应用程序的无缝切换。
-
可定制性和灵活性:云服务器可以根据用户的需求进行定制和配置。用户可以选择所需的操作系统、硬件配置和网络设置来创建自己的虚拟实例。此外,用户还可以根据需要随时进行扩展或缩小虚拟实例的规模,以满足不断变化的业务需求。
通过虚拟化技术、弹性扩展、负载均衡、高可用性和可定制性,云服务器或云主机能够提供灵活且可靠的计算和存储能力,满足不同用户的需求。这种工作原理使云服务器成为了现代IT架构中的重要组成部分。
1年前 -
-
云服务器,也叫云主机,是基于云计算技术的一种虚拟化服务器,它能够通过互联网提供计算资源,包括处理能力、存储空间和网络带宽等。
云服务器的工作原理可以分为以下几个步骤:
-
资源管理:云服务器通过一个资源管理系统来管理计算、存储和网络资源。该系统可以根据用户需求动态分配和调整资源,确保按需提供。
-
虚拟化技术:云服务器使用虚拟化技术将一台物理服务器划分为多个虚拟机,每个虚拟机都可以独立运行操作系统和应用程序。虚拟机之间相互隔离,互不影响。
-
负载均衡:云服务器通过负载均衡技术将用户的请求分发到多台虚拟机上,以实现资源的优化利用和增加系统的稳定性。负载均衡可以根据虚拟机的运行状态动态调整请求的分配。
-
弹性扩展:云服务器具有弹性扩展的能力,可以根据用户需求扩展或缩减虚拟机的数量。当用户的负载增加时,可以自动创建新的虚拟机来处理请求;当负载减少时,可以自动释放多余的虚拟机,以节省资源。
-
数据备份和恢复:云服务器通过定期的数据备份和灾难恢复机制来保护用户的数据安全。备份可以在不影响正常运行的情况下进行,并且可以在需要时快速恢复。
-
访问控制和安全性:云服务器通过访问控制策略和安全机制来保护用户的数据和资源安全。用户可以根据需要设置访问权限,并采取加密、防火墙等安全措施来增强数据的保护。
总的来说,云服务器的工作原理是基于虚拟化技术,通过资源管理、负载均衡、弹性扩展、数据备份和安全机制等来提供高可用、弹性和安全的计算资源。用户可以根据自己的需求动态分配和调整资源,从而实现灵活、高效的服务提供。
1年前 -